#4febbb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4febbb is composed of 31% red, 92.2%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.4%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 161.5 degrees, a saturation of 79.6% and a lightness of 61.6%. #4febbb color hex could be obtained by blending #9effff with #00d777.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

#4febbb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4febbb has RGB values of R:79, G:235, B:187 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0, Y:0.2,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 5237691.

							Shades and Tints of #4febbb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#eefd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4febbb
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9aa09e is the less saturated color, while #40fac1 is the most saturated one.
